Özet

Coke is a porous substance with a high carbon concentration. During the production of coke, wastewater containing harmful organic and inorganic pollutants is generated. When the coking wastewater is discharged into a water body without treatment, it increases toxicity, lowers DO, settles suspended particulates, elevates temperature, and causes oil slicks. This chapter introduces the treatment solutions for coke oven wastewater. The available methods were classified as physicochemical, biological, and advanced oxidation processes. While biological treatment is frequently recommended for eliminating organic contaminants at a low cost, the presence of hazardous pollutants such as phenol, cyanide, and other chemicals is problematic for microorganisms. To reduce the toxicity of coking wastewater, integrated advanced treatment employing a physicochemical–biochemical combination approach is required.
